Receptionist (Schedule 5:30 am-2:00 pm)

We offer competitive salaries, full benefits package, Paid Time Off, and opportunities for professional growth.

Pinnacle Treatment Centers is a growing leader in addiction treatment services. We provide care across the nation touching the lives of more than 35,000 patients daily.

Our mission is to remove all barriers to recovery and transform individuals, families, and communities with treatment that works.

Our employees believe we are creating a better world where lives and communities are made whole again through comprehensive treatment.

As a Receptionist, you are responsible for creating a positive patient-centric experience by providing excellent customer service to patients. You will perform all reception, secretarial/clerical aspects of the program including cash collection and assisting with ordering supplies.

Benefits
  • 18 days PTO (Paid Time Off)
  • 401k with company match
  • Company sponsored ongoing training and certification opportunities.
  • Full comprehensive benefits package including medical, dental, vision, short term disability, long term disability and accident insurance.
  • Substance Use Disorder Treatment and Recovery Loan Repayment Program (STAR LRP)
  • Discounted tuition and scholarships through Capella University.
Requirements
  • HS diploma/ GED or verifiable work experience in lieu of education
  • One (1) year of experience in an office setting; experience in the medical field a plus
  • Valid driver’s license in good standing
  • Ability to travel up to 10% as needed
Preferred
  • Associate’s degree
  • One (1) year experience working in substance use and/or mental health field.
Responsibilities
  • Welcome visitors / patients by greeting them in person or on the telephone; answering or referral inquiries.
  • Responsible for cash collection and daily balancing.
  • Responsible for all clerical functions, including typing, filing, mail/correspondence flow, electronic organization of files, etc.
  • Responsible for daily phone coverage functions
  • Comply with all policies and applicable procedures.
  • Maintain security by following procedures, monitoring logbooks, checking in visitors, etc.
  • Coordinate appointments for patients.
  • Communicate all relevant information to the supervisory team regarding patients and the facility.
  • Manage accounts receivable/accounts payable/ deposits.
  • Maintain safe and clean reception area by complying with policies, procedures, and regulations.
  • Process intakes, assist guest doing, upload documents in HER/EMR, coordinate with billing for private insurance.
  • Attend team meetings and complete all training courses timely as required.
  • Other duties as assigned
